On 9/16/2019 at 6:11 AM, Mynameislol said:

Upscaling usually don't work very well on audio, but it will be interesting to hear how they sound


The upscaling definitely isn't as good as getting the source audio. But it does increase the brightness of sounds. I attached a sample of one of the sounds I have upscaled.

The techniques I use are frequency multiplying (iZotope radius) and a script I wrote which uses linear prediction in frequency space. Indeed they often sound worse after those methods. But it gives me higher frequencies to work with and edit to something hopefully reasonable...

I have made some findings regarding sound sources that should justify bumping this thread.

 

1.     DSFIRXPL source is short section with 2x tempo of this stock thunder sound: THUNDER - THUNDER CLAP AND RUMBLE, WEATHER 04 https://www.stockmusic.com/#!details?id=22792483 It comes from good old Sound Ideas Series 6000 library.
Here´s my try at recreating it: https://www.mediafire.com/file/atksxa6t69p2nz4/DSFIRXPL.wav/file


2.    Slightly clearer 22khz version of archvile idle sound can be found in RomTech Galaxy of Home Office Help: WAV Sound Effects https://archive.org/details/GalaxyOfHomeOfficeHelpWAVSoundEffects Name of the sound is HOWL001 and it is located on CARTOON -> MONSTERS folder.
Here´s the sound itself: https://www.mediafire.com/file/l5xucr4vtqzqrvt/HOWL001.WAV/file


3.    Arachnotron idle sound source or part of it is propably this sound: OFFICE, MACHINE - OLD DATA SPEED MACHINE.  https://soundeffects.fandom.com/wiki/Sound_Ideas,_OFFICE,_MACHINE_-_OLD_DATA_SPEED_MACHINE It comes from 20th Century Fox Sound Library

On lundi 16 août 2021 at 6:31 PM, ColorSphere said:

3.    Arachnotron idle sound source or part of it is propably this sound: OFFICE, MACHINE - OLD DATA SPEED MACHINE.  https://soundeffects.fandom.com/wiki/Sound_Ideas,_OFFICE,_MACHINE_-_OLD_DATA_SPEED_MACHINE It comes from 20th Century Fox Sound Library

It might be the same sound; but it cannot be where it came from as far as Doom's development is concerned, since Sound Ideas published the 20th Century Fox Sound Library in 1995...
